About radio
Oxide Radio is a British radio station that is run by students of Oxford University in Oxford, England. It was established in 2001 and has been broadcasting online since 2005, after facing difficulties with FM licensing and funding.
Oxide Radio features a wide range of shows that cover music, chat, news, sports, and drama. The station plays music of all genres, from indie to Nordic, from gospel to hip-hop, from classical to metal. The station also hosts chat shows that offer advice, opinions, interviews, and entertainment. The station also produces news and sport bulletins that keep the listeners informed of the latest stories in Oxford and beyond. The station also showcases radio drama, both original and adapted, that explore various themes and genres.
Oxide Radio is a student radio station that aims to provide a platform for the diverse and creative voices of Oxford University. The station is run by a committee of students who oversee the programming, production, marketing, and management of the station. The station is open to any student who wants to get involved, either as a presenter, producer, technician, or writer. The station also collaborates with other student societies and organisations to promote events and causes.
